2. US Fed cuts rates for first time in 2025 amid pressure from Trump, weaker job outlook
The US Federal Reserve has announced that it will cut interest rates by a quarter of 1 percentage point in a widely anticipated move. The US central bank also expects two more quarter-point cuts this year.
3. China’s job market woes deepen as youth unemployment hits record since 2023

China’s urban youth unemployment rate rose last month to the highest level since the data set was adjusted in 2023, as career prospects for young people have weakened amid an economic slowdown.
